8GB DDR4-2133 ECC RDIMM

This 8GB DDR4-2133 registered DIMM adds error-correcting capacity to compatible HP server platforms. It targets administrators who need to expand memory in existing infrastructure without replacing the chassis. The module uses major-brand DRAM and matches the HP 753220-S21 specification for drop-in compatibility. It is not suited for desktop boards that require unbuffered non-ECC memory.

Registered ECC at 1.2 V

The stick runs at 1.20 V with a CL15 latency and a single 1Rx4 rank. Registered buffering reduces electrical load on the memory controller, helping stability when many modules are populated. ECC circuitry detects and corrects single-bit errors to protect data integrity in continuous workloads. Power draw scales with the number of populated slots rather than with a single high-wattage component.

288-pin DDR4 server upgrade

Installation requires a DDR4 RDIMM slot that supports 2133 MT/s operation and registered ECC modules. The 288-pin form factor fits standard server DIMM sockets and leaves other expansion bays unaffected. Builders who need higher densities or load-reduced LRDIMMs must select different modules. Systems limited to unbuffered memory cannot use this stick.

Questions about this item

How do I install the 288-Pin DDR4 RDIMM in my server, and what step do people often miss?

Power down the server, open the chassis, align the notch on the 288-Pin module with the slot key, press firmly until both clips lock, then verify in BIOS that the 8GB module registers at 2133 MHz with ECC enabled.

What maintenance or replacement will the 8GB DDR4-2133 ECC Registered module need over its service life?

The module has no moving parts and requires no scheduled maintenance; replacement is only needed if a memory error persists after reseating or if a capacity upgrade is required.

What is the first limit that appears when the 1Rx4 CL15 1.2V RDIMM runs under sustained load?

The CAS latency of CL15 at 2133 MHz sets the timing floor; sustained throughput cannot exceed the PC4-17000 bandwidth ceiling of the module.
